First Stitch, First Impression: How It Reads on Fabric

I tested Retro Boho Tropical Houseplants SVG PNG as a centered chest embroidery on a heavyweight organic cotton tote—exactly the kind small shop owners stock for weekend markets. On screen, the design feels airy; in stitch, it held up beautifully. The leaf outlines use clean satin stitch edges, while interior fill areas are open enough to avoid stiffness—even at 3.5" wide. No dense fill zones that would buckle lightweight linen or mute texture on canvas. That’s critical: this isn’t a design that fights fabric. It partners with it. When stitched in muted sage and cream thread on oat-colored canvas, it looked handmade but polished—not craft-fair-cute, not boutique-sterile. Customers paused at the booth. They didn’t just see “a plant.” They saw *vibe*: grounded, warm, quietly confident.

Where It Shines (and Where It Asks for Care)

This set excels in projects where personality matters more than precision: embroidered sweatshirt cuffs, pillow covers for sun-drenched living rooms, aprons for ceramic studios, and nursery wall hangings where softness and intentionality read louder than detail.

That said, Retro Boho Tropical Houseplants SVG PNG isn’t built for micro-detail work. Don’t push it below 2.2" wide on thin knits—it loses legibility in the stem joints and inner veining. On dark fabric, test contrast first: some leaf interiors rely on subtle tonal shifts that vanish without mid-tone thread. And skip it for high-wash items like kitchen towels unless you reinforce with a lightweight cutaway stabilizer and lock stitches at entry/exit points.

Practical Designer Notes Before You Stitch

Before cutting fabric or loading your machine:

  1. Test the Retro Boho Tropical Houseplants SVG PNG on scrap fabric matching your final project’s weight and stretch—especially if using knits or textured weaves.
  2. Check thread color contrast on both light and dark backgrounds. Some stems use fine running stitch; low-contrast thread will disappear.
  3. Review stitch density visually—not just numerically. Look for tight clusters near leaf tips or overlapping stems. Adjust underlay if needed.
  4. Confirm hoop size compatibility. Most motifs sit comfortably in a 4x4 hoop, but the full cluster may require 5x7. Don’t assume.
  5. Inspect small details in black-and-white mockups. Does the silhouette hold? Does negative space read as intentional—or accidental?
  6. Use appropriate stabilizer: tear-away for stable wovens, cutaway for knits or high-wear items like aprons.
  7. Verify licensing terms. Since this falls under Illustrations and Graphics, confirm whether commercial use of finished products (e.g., selling embroidered totes) is permitted—and whether resale of the digital embroidery file itself is restricted.
